Complete question

<em>18. GOLF Luis and three friends went golfing. Two of the friends rented clubs for $6 each. The total cost of the rented </em>

<em>clubs and the green fees for each person was $76. What was the cost of the green fees for each person? Define a </em>

<em>variable, write an equation, and solve the problem.</em>

The variable defined is "y", the equation is 4y + 2(6) = 76 and the value of the unknown variable is 16

Let the cost of green fees per person be y

If Luis and three friends went golfing, this means that 4 people went golfing.  The total cost of green fees for all of them will be $4y

If two of the friends rented clubs for $6 each, total amount spent will be $2(6)

The equation that models the statement will then be expressed as;

4y + 2(6) = 76\\

Solve for y

4y + 2(6) = 76\\4y+12 = 76\\4y = 76 - 12\\4y = 64\\y =\frac{64}{4}\\y = 16

The variable defined is "y", the equation is 4y + 2(6) = 76 and the value of the unknown variable is 16.
